Crema's Take
“The real draw here is the genuinely exceptional pastries—croissants and waffles that locals rave about—paired with a genuinely warm, personable staff that makes you feel like a regular on day one. Just know that the coffee itself is inconsistent (some say it's perfectly fine, others report watered-down shots), and the selection changes daily based on what they've baked, so you're working with limited options. It's a solid choice for a leisurely breakfast and pastry run in a beautiful space, but don't come expecting specialty coffee or predictability.”
